Ghana defender Lumor Agbenyenu completed his move to Turkish top-flight side Goztepe on Wednesday night.
The 22-year-old swapped Portuguese giants Sporting Lisbon for Goztepe after the two clubs reached an agreement.
The left-back is penned a six-month loan deal at the Turkish Super Lig side with the Goztepe retaining the right to make the deal permanent.
He will join the training of the side on Thursday as he has been signed to boost the defence of the club.
It emerged late last year that Agbenyenu was close to leaving the José Alvalade Stadium after failing to churn out regular playing time.
The Ghanaian was linked with a loan move to several clubs in Europe including French club FC Amiens and PSV Eindhoven.
However, Goztepe won the race to sign the enterprising left-back and he is expected to start training immediately after passing the medical.
He has made only eight appearances in all competitions for Sporting CP since joining them from Portimonense around a transfer fee of 2.5 million euros.
Agbenyenu has capped nine times for the senior national team of Ghana.
